.
QQ扫一扫联系
Oracle无法识别:解决数据库识别问题的方法与技巧
在数据库管理中,遇到数据库无法识别的问题是一种常见的情况。Oracle作为一种广泛使用的关系型数据库管理系统,也可能遇到类似的情况。数据库无法识别可能涉及连接问题、权限问题、网络问题等多个方面。在本文中,我们将探讨一些常见的情况,以及解决Oracle数据库无法识别问题的方法和技巧。
连接问题可能是导致Oracle数据库无法识别的主要原因之一。当应用程序尝试连接数据库时,可能会出现连接超时、连接被拒绝等情况。这可能是因为数据库实例未启动、监听器故障或者网络不稳定等原因。
解决方法:
权限问题可能导致数据库无法识别用户或应用程序。如果数据库连接尝试使用了错误的用户名或密码,数据库将无法识别用户并拒绝连接。
解决方法:
Oracle数据库的连接通常会使用tnsnames.ora
文件中的连接描述符。如果描述符配置不正确,数据库可能无法识别连接。
解决方法:
tnsnames.ora
文件中的连接描述符是否正确配置。网络问题可能导致数据库和应用程序之间的通信中断,从而导致数据库无法识别连接请求。
解决方法:
Oracle数据库通常会生成日志和错误信息,帮助诊断连接问题。查阅数据库的日志和错误信息可以帮助确定问题的根本原因。
解决方法:
防火墙和其他安全设置可能会影响数据库连接。如果防火墙阻止了数据库端口的访问,那么数据库就无法识别连接请求。
解决方法:
Oracle数据库无法识别的问题可能涉及多个方面,包括连接问题、权限问题、配置问题等。在解决这些问题时,需要仔细排查,根据具体情况来采取相应的解决方法。通过检查数据库的日志、错误信息以及配置文件,可以更准确地找出问题的根本原因。在数据库管理中,持续学习和熟悉数据库的运行和配置,能够帮助更快速地解决问题,确保数据库的正常运行和稳定性。
.